Hua Zhao is a scholar working on Organic Chemistry, Inorganic Chemistry and Process Chemistry and Technology. According to data from OpenAlex, Hua Zhao has authored 17 papers receiving a total of 400 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 16 papers in Organic Chemistry, 4 papers in Inorganic Chemistry and 2 papers in Process Chemistry and Technology. Recurrent topics in Hua Zhao’s work include Catalytic C–H Functionalization Methods (11 papers), Catalytic Cross-Coupling Reactions (6 papers) and Synthesis and Catalytic Reactions (6 papers). Hua Zhao is often cited by papers focused on Catalytic C–H Functionalization Methods (11 papers), Catalytic Cross-Coupling Reactions (6 papers) and Synthesis and Catalytic Reactions (6 papers). Hua Zhao collaborates with scholars based in China, Germany and South Korea. Hua Zhao's co-authors include Hongbin Zhai, Hongjian Sun, Xiaoyan Li, Huifei Wang, Taimin Wang, Tao Cheng, Shengxian Zhai, Shuxian Qiu, Bin Cheng and Yun Li and has published in prestigious journals such as Chemical Communications, The Journal of Organic Chemistry and Molecules.
